Question implants for overdentures

I just had implants (2) in order to snap in dentures. All information on line has had the implants placed in the 22 & 27(cuspids or eye teeth) positions. Mine are right in the center (24 & 25)
of my gums. Has any one ever had this done, I can't see it working. The implants were just uncovered and healing caps put on, it will be a couple of weeks before I go to have them connected to the dentures. When the dentist uncovered the implants he did not show them to me but put my temp denture back in. I asked before I started this process if my bone was good to do it and he said yes. If during the surgery he found a problem shouldn't he have stopped. Any comments or suggestions will be appreciated

Hi there,

Ideally the positions of the implants are bes tin the canine regions of the mouth, however, sometimes available bone and local anatomy means we have to put them elsewhere! On the whole, the modern day attatchements that are used to hold dentures onto implants are so good, you wont really notice a difference!
